Set against the backdrop of Cleveland's transformation from 1948 to 1969, the story follows David Zielinsky and Anne O'Connor, whose love story unfolds amidst the social and political upheaval of the era. As reluctant star-crossed lovers, their relationship reflects the challenges of a turbulent country. The narrative intertwines real-life figures like Eliot Ness and Carl Stokes, showcasing the city's history with a blend of skepticism and affection. Mark Winegardner's storytelling captures the essence of Cleveland, creating a vivid and poignant epic.
